What is the PTCMW Mentor Program?
- The PTCMW Mentor Program is an opportunity for students and young professionals to benefit from the knowledge and experience of other PTCMW members
How does it work?
- Mentors will meet once a month with mentees via phone or video conference to discuss mutual topics of interest over a 6-month period
Who can be a mentee?
- Any PTCMW member* with an interest in gaining knowledge and advice from PTCMW’s wise and seasoned base of professionals
-
- We are currently waiving the membership fee for students and early career mentees until the end of 2020
Who can be a mentor?
- Any PTCMW member with an interest in sharing knowledge and experience with other PTCMW members
- Other guidelines:
- Master’s degree or higher in IO Psychology or closely related field
- 1+ Years of I/O related work experience in a full time capacity
- Availability to commit at least one hour per month to meeting with your mentee
